HIDDEN GEM OF RAJASTHAN

The Hanuman
Mandir of Pandupol is a famous temple located inside the Sariska National Tiger
Reserve in Rajasthan. In which a huge idol of Lord Hanuman is installed in a
calm position. The ancient Hanuman Temple of Pandupol, situated amidst the high
ridged hills of the Aravalli range, is one of the most visited places in Alwar.
The temple complex is also famous for langurs, macaques, and a variety of birds
and for its gorgeous 35-foot waterfall. Pandupol is believed to belong to the
period of the epic of Mahabharata. The Pandavas are believed to have spent some
years of their lives at Pandupol during their exile. According to another
legend, this Pandupol was the place where Lord Hanuman defeated Bhima and
curbed his pride.
The history
of Pandupol Hanuman temple is believed to be 5000 years old, according to the
ancient epic- Mahabharata, Bhima struck the mountain with his mace, due to
which the way through the mountain came out and the door built on the mountain
was established by the name of Pandupol Hanuman temple. According to another story,
Pandupol was the place where Lord Hanuman defeated Bhima and curbed his pride.
According to
an incident from the Mahabharata period, Draupadi had gone to take a bath in
the river's reservoir downstream of this valley as per her regular routine. One
day, while taking a bath, a beautiful flower flowing in the water came from
above in the drain, Draupadi, express great happiness after receiving that
flower and thought of wearing it as her earrings. After bathing, Draupadi asked
Mahabali Bhima to bring that flower, then Bhima started moving towards the
stream, searching for the flower. Ongoing forward, Bhima saw that an old giant
monkey was lying comfortably with its tail spread and the path was completely
blocked by the monkey.
Due to the narrow valley, there was no other way for Bhima to get ahead. Bhima said to the old monkey lying on the way that if he can put his tail out of the way in the reply the monkey said that he’s old age Bhima can go over it, then Bhima replied that he cannot go over his tail rather he should move aside. On this the monkey said that Bhima looked strong, so he can remove his tail. When Bhima tried to remove the monkey's tail, the tail did not move an inch from Bhima. Even after repeated efforts by Bhima the tail of the old monkey did not move then Bhima understood that he is not just an ordinary monkey.
Bhima
pleaded with folded hands to the old monkey to reveal his true form. On this,
the old monkey revealed his true form and introduced himself as Lord Hanuman.
Bhima called all the Pandavas there and worshiped the old monkey in a lying
form. After this, the Pandavas established the Hanuman temple there, which is
today known as Pandupol Hanuman Mandir. Now a large number of devotees reach
here every Tuesday and Saturday, the temple is the center of faith of the
people.
Lakkhi Mela
of Pandupol Hanuman Temple is a popular fair of Alwar that fills the Ashtami of
Bhadau Shukla Paksha every year. About 50 thousand devotees from Delhi, Punjab,
Madhya Pradesh, and other places come to visit Pandupol Hanuman Temple on the
occasion of Lakkhi Mela. If you are planning to visit Pandupol Hanuman Temple,
then let us tell you that October to March is considered to be the best time to
visit Pandupol Hanuman Temple. Pandupol Hanuman Temple is open for tourists
daily from 5.00 am to 10.00 pm.
